Abstract

The invention discloses a multi-module parallel input circuit for reverse connection prevention, overvoltage and undervoltage protection and isolation startup and shutdown. The multi-module parallel input circuit comprises a reverse connection prevention circuit, an overvoltage protection circuit, an undervoltage protection circuit, a multi-power-supply-module parallel input circuit and an isolation startup and shutdown circuit. The circuit has the advantage of realizing the functions of reverse connection prevention, overvoltage and undervoltage protection and isolation startup and shutdown. A reverse connection prevention circuit is realized by using a PMOS transistor and a voltage stabilizing tube, so that the module is prevented from being damaged by reverse connection input. The voltage stabilizing tube and the triode are used for realizing an overvoltage and undervoltage protection circuit, and the module can still work normally when normal voltage is input again after overvoltage and undervoltage; and the module is ensured not to work outside the specified range of the input voltage. The optocoupler is used for realizing isolation between module input ground and startup and shutdown control ground, thereby ensuring stable and reliable operation of the circuit. The circuit structure is simple, and the component cost is economical. And the expensive cost of the traditional voltage sampling for an operational amplifier chip and an independent source is avoided. Therefore, the efficiency of the whole machine is also improved.

technical field [0001] The invention relates to the field of input circuits, in particular to a multi-module parallel input circuit for anti-reverse connection, over-undervoltage protection and isolation switch. Background technique [0002] In the research and development of some electronic products, not only voltage and current supplies of various specifications are required, but also small size, light weight, and high efficiency are required; therefore, multi-power modules are widely used in electronic product research and development, and the single output of multi-power modules can avoid crossover Disadvantages of interference. However, the current design of the input circuit of the multi-module power supply has the disadvantage of non-isolated hard switch, which directly cuts off the input voltage, and the switch will cause the interference of peak current and peak voltage under the condition of full load.
